Dr. Changhui Zhao is a leading innovator in the field of advanced functional materials, with a primary focus on developing high-performance, wearable piezoresistive sensors. His most cited work introduces a groundbreaking approach using Ta₄C₃ nanosheet/melamine sponges, a novel composite that achieves exceptional sensitivity and remarkable long-term stability. This contribution directly addresses a critical bottleneck in wearable technology: the trade-off between high sensitivity, durability, and cost-effectiveness. By engineering a stable suspension of Ta₄C₃ nanosheets, Dr. Zhao has created a pressure-sensitive material that not only outperforms existing solutions but also offers a scalable, low-cost pathway for next-generation electronic skin and health-monitoring devices.
